Mandala stones look detailed and peaceful in a garden nook or on a porch table. Their round patterns create a balanced and eye-catching design.
Dot tools, cotton swabs, or the end of a paintbrush can help make the circles. Start with a center dot and build outward in layers for a neat pattern. These stones feel special because each one looks rich and thoughtful, even when the materials are simple.
Many people like mandala art because it feels relaxing to make and pleasant to look at. You can choose sunset colors, ocean colors, or earth tones based on your outdoor space. A small group of mandala stones can also make a lovely gift or table accent.
Seal them well if they will sit outside in damp weather. If you want a softer look, leave some stone color showing between the painted rings. That mix of natural rock and color gives the piece extra charm.

Glow-in-the-dark stones add fun after sunset. They can light up a path, edge a flower bed, or make a porch corner feel magical.
Use glow paint on stars, dots, swirls, or simple arrows so the shapes are easy to see at night. The stones should charge in daylight, so place them where the sun can reach them during the day. This trend is popular because it mixes art with a bit of surprise.
Choose smooth stones with enough flat space for the glow design. You can paint the daytime side in bright colors and hide the glow on top for two looks in one stone. That makes the project feel extra clever and fun.
These stones are helpful as well as pretty, since they can mark a path in the dark. A small set can be made for very little money if you already own glow paint. To keep the effect strong, clean the stones before painting and let each coat dry well.
